    ECSC Responds After High Court Judge Shawn Innocent Charged with Assault

    The Eastern Caribbean Supreme Court (ECSC) has been recently made aware that Justice Shawn Innocent, a High Court Judge currently assigned to the Criminal court in Grenada, was on 28th April 2025, charged with the indictable offence of “assault with a deadly instrument,” contrary to section 176(e) of the Criminal Code of Grenada. Following this charge, Justice Innocent was granted bail until his court appearance, where he is expected to respond to the allegations.

    In light of these circumstances, Justice Innocent has been temporarily de-rostered. To minimise the disruption of proceedings in the Criminal court in Grenada, another judge has been assigned to assume Justice Innocent’s responsibilities, effective 1st June 2025.

    The ECSC is approaching this matter with the utmost seriousness, being mindful of Justice Innocent’s fundamental rights under the Constitution, while reaffirming its dedication to upholding the rule of law and maintaining the integrity of the judiciary.
